Are you passionate about helping residents, resolving concerns fairly and using feedback to improve services?
The Information Governance team supports good governance across the Council, overseeing data protection, UK GDPR, information requests, housing and corporate complaints, and Member and MP enquiries.
As Information Governance Administrator, you will play a key role in supporting and improving how the Council manages formal complaints, Member enquiries and MP enquiries. You will help make sure complaints and enquiries are recorded accurately, progressed promptly and responded to fairly, consistently and within required timescales. You will also support the team to monitor complaint performance, identify themes and learning, and provide clear updates to help improve services for residents.
This is a varied and meaningful role where your work will help strengthen transparency, accountability and service improvement across the Council. You will work closely with colleagues across service areas, helping to gather information, track actions and keep accurate records so that complaints and information requests are managed effectively.
